After preparing to take the AP tests, where you must write a page or two well-written essay in forty-five minutes, I am quite good at getting my ideas out legibly and fast handwritten, whereas I'm forever making typos on the computer. So generally I prefer handwriting the very initial stages of stuff, like plot or the first scenes that pop into my head. Then when I'm ready to actually make it a story I pull it onto the computer.
The biggest advantage to handwriting for me is I don't have to write left to right, top down. I can make arrows and spin my paper around and write comments and circle things very easily. It's a great way to brainstorm, because I see my ideas best when they're all squished together on one sheet of paper that mimics the way they appear in my head. It's much more direct, if less practical. |
